How I celebrate Easter in England.
Woodlands Junior School is in the south-east corner of England

Hi, my name is James and I want to tell you what I do in England during the festival of Easter.

Easter is the time when we celebrate the resurrection of Christ from the dead.

At school we have an Easter competition. Last year it was an Easter Bonnet competition. We designed and made colourful hats on the theme of Easter and Spring. This year we are going to make Easter Minature Gardens. I am going to make mine in a tin and plant real plants.

egg huntWe also have an egg hunt. This is my favourite Easter activity at school. Small chocolate eggs are hidden around the school and we try to find them.

We have two weeks off school when it is Easter. We finish school a few days before the Easter weekend.

On Good Friday, my mum toasts Hot Cross Buns for tea.

I like them with butter.

On Easter Sunday, I get up very early. My family join other families on a hill to watch the sun rise. We then have breakfast with the other families.

After breakfast we all go to church for a service to celebrate Jesus rising from the dead.

 

chocolate eggsAfterwards, at home, everyone gives each other chocolate eggs. Children in England get big ones filled with sweets. I do not eat mine all at once, that would be greedy. I save some of mine to eat during the week.

 

I usually either play on my Playstation or I watch television forthe rest of the morning.

For dinner (12:00 noon) mum cooks roast lamb.

After dinner, my mum and dad hide small chocolate eggs in the garden for my sister and I to find. I love playing this game and usually beat my sister in collecting the most. Of course, I always give her some so that we have the same about.

Later in the afternoon, my aunt and uncle and cousins come over for tea. We have a special Easter Cake for tea.
